well the breeder I choose to get my lovebird from actually got them from another breeder and the parents plucked most of the babies feathers. The bird I picked out is 5 weeks old and still doesn't have all of his feathers, I mean they are growing but the breeder seems to think my baby(he's the oldest one) will be ready in a week or two. Will it be ok to take him home if he is weaned but still doesn't have all his feathers? Confused

I read that sometimes the parents pluck the babies if they have mites. You might want to make sure that they don't have them. With taking a baby home even though it doesn't have all of its feathers (as long as it's weaned) should be okay. Just make sure he or she doesn't get too cold and to keep it out of direct sunlight as bare skin can get sunburned sometimes.
